#a690be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a690be is composed of 65.1% red, 56.5%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 24.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 268.7 degrees, a saturation of 26.1% and a lightness of 65.5%. #a690be color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4d217d.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#a690be color description : Grayish violet.

#a690be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a690be has RGB values of R:166, G:144,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 10916030.

Shades and Tints of #a690be

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f5f3f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a690be

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a4aa is the less saturated color, while #a353fb is the most saturated one.
